Dallara will make minor modifications to the DW12 IndyCar chassis before Carb Day practice at Indianapolis to further reduce the chances of cars becoming airborne in accidents.

The Italian company ascertained that the lateral stiffness of the new IndyCar's underwing supports had contributed to cars lifting slightly off the ground in some of the crashes during qualifying weekend. Preventing cars taking to the air in accidents was a key safety goal in the design of the new generation IndyCar chassis.

Dallara is therefore cutting slots into the cars' underwing supports in order to "lessen lateral and maintain vertical stiffness", according to an IndyCar statement, which added that the incidents that had concerned Dallara occurred on three occasions when a car "impacted the SAFER Barrier with the car's centreline parallel to the wall."

IndyCar's vice president of technology Will Phillips praised Dallara's prompt action.

"Dallara's response has been immediate to try and make sure all improvements possible could be implemented in time for the race - all credit to them," said Phillips.

"Feedback from observers, safety officials and drivers enabled Dallara to have the data very quickly, and their solution and response is a great example of how safety comes first."

If you look at stills or slow the video before Claussen hits the wall, only the front tires are skidding because the rears are a few inches off the ground, then the car his the wall. However I wonder if given more room and time if the back wouldn't end up lifting off like a NASCAR style wreck. I honestly would have thought Kimball and Carpenter going up on the side were due to the fact that the left front hit the wall first and swung the back into it and then got rebounded off the safer barrier. I certainly applaud Dallara and hope we have a great and safe race!

Today, may 24th, 20 years ago Little Al won his first Indy 500 on an incredible chase in the end. Unlike 1989, Al Unser Jr found breath out of nowhere to hold a furious Scott Goodyear. Goodyear tried a slingshot in the last seconds but that wasn't enough. The redemption of a legend.
